Poland’s PM Tusk says confidence vote on his authorities will happen June 11

WARSAW, Poland — Poland’s Prime Minister Donald Tusk stated Tuesday that parliament will maintain a confidence vote on his authorities on June 11.

He called for the vote after his political ally, the liberal Warsaw mayor, misplaced Poland’s weekend presidential election to conservative Karol Nawrocki.

Tusk’s authorities runs a lot of the day-to-day issues in Poland. It additionally exists individually from the presidency, however the president holds energy to veto legal guidelines, and Nawrocki’s win will make it extraordinarily tough for Tusk to press his pro-European agenda.

Tusk introduced the date of the arrogance vote at the beginning of a Cupboard assembly in Warsaw.

“We’re beginning the session in a brand new political actuality,” Tusk stated. “The political actuality is new, as a result of we’ve a brand new president. However the structure, our obligations and the expectations of residents haven’t modified. In Poland, the federal government guidelines, which is a superb obligation and honor.”

Nawrocki, who was supported by U.S. President Donald Trump, received 50.89% of votes in a good race towards Warsaw Mayor Rafał Trzaskowski, who acquired 49.11%.

The race revealed deep divisions within the nation alongside the japanese flank of NATO and the European Union.
